当前位置: 首页 > news >正文

从零安装 Claude Code

从零安装 Claude Code()

1. 安装 Claude Code

1.1下载node.js

下载地址:Node.js — 下载 Node.js®

2.安装

2.1 自定义安装路径(可以选择默认)

下图根据本身的需要进行,我选择了默认Node.js runtime,然后Next:

自定义安装路径,这里建议不要装在C盘,直接把C:\Program Files\nodejs 改成E:\Program Files\nodejs(D盘和E盘都可以,我这里装的是E盘)

这一步的选项Automatically install the necessary tools(自动安装所需工具)决定了是否安装用于编译原生模块的依赖项。这包括 Python 和 Visual Studio Build Tools 等工具。(建议不勾选,勾选安装较慢,看个人选择)

安装成功后,在安装路径的根目录下新建两个文件夹,node_cache和node_global,如图所示:

Step3:环境配置

建好以后开始配置环境:右键此电脑——属性——高级系统设置 ——高级——环境变量

在系统变量里新建一个NODE_HOME,变量值为安装路径:E:\Program Files\nodejs

然后再在系统变量的【path】中添加
  • %NODE_HOME%
  • %NODE_HOME%\node_global
  • %NODE_HOME%\node_cache
然后将用户变量默认的C:\User\35025\AppDate\Roaming\npm改成E:\Program Files\nodejs\node_global

到这一步,环境就已经完全配好了,现在开始查看。

4.查看

键盘Win+R进入cmd,然后依次输入

【注意:此时是打开CMD窗口,并非在C:\Program Files\nodejs目录下执行node.exe】

node -v
npm -v

像这样会出现你安装的版本号

然后在cmd中执行如下命令,配置缓存目录和全局目录
  1. 设置全局模块

  2. npm config set prefix "E:\Program Files\nodejs\node_global"(路径需跟你配置路径一致)

如果出现标红报错,是由于权限的原因,右击Nodejs文件夹->属性->安全,点击编辑,将所有权限都 ✔即可。

5.更换npm源为淘宝镜像(这里是淘宝源,也可以安装自己找的npm源)

npm 默认的 registry ,也就是下载 npm 包时是从国外的服务器下载,国内很慢,一般都会指向淘宝 https://registry.npmmirror.com。

在cmd里输入npm config set registry https://registry.npmmirror.com

检查配置是否成功

npm config get registry

1.2下载git

  • 官网地址:Redirecting…

  • 选择版本:点击"Click here to download"

  1. 选择安装路径 (关键!)

修改路径:为了配合我们之前的 Node.js,建议安装在E:\Program Files\Git(确保路径不含中文)。

点击 Next。

2.选择组件 (Select Components)
  • 建议勾选 "Add a Git Bash Profile to Windows Terminal"(因为要用终端的话)。

  • 其他保持默认即可。

  • 点击 Next。

3.选择默认编辑器 (Choosing the default editor)

4.初始化 分支名 (Adjusting the name of the initial branch)
  • 选择第二个 "Override the default branch name for new repositories"。

  • 在框里填入 main(最好记住,默认名就好)。

  • 点击 Next。

5.调整环境变量 (Adjusting your PATH environment)
  • 选择默认

  • 然后点击 Next。

6.换行符转换 (Configuring the line ending conversions)

选择 "Checkout Windows-style, commit Unix-style line endings",然后直接点击 "Next"。

7.终端模拟器选择

选择 "Use MinTTY (the default terminal of MSYS2)"。它的体验比 Windows 自带的 CMD 好很多。

点击 Next。

8.剩余步骤

后面关于 git pull 行为、凭证管理器等选项,全部保持默认,一路 Next 到底,最后点击 Install。

第三步:验证安装

按 Win + R 键,输入 "cmd" 打开命令提示符,输入命令检查版本:git -v,如果显示版本号,说明安装成功。

1.3下载claude

1.下载claude
  • 在命令行界面,执行以下命令安装 Claude Code:

npm install -g @anthropic-ai/claude-code
  • 安装结束后,执行以下命令,若显示版本号则安装成功:

claude --version
2. 配置claude环境变量(在cmd依次输入)
这里我使用的是deepseek-v4-pro,如要使用GPT,请自行配置环境变量
set ANTHROPIC_BASE_URL=https://api.deepseek.com/anthropic set ANTHROPIC_AUTH_TOKEN=你的key set ANTHROPIC_MODEL=deepseek-v4-pro[1m] set ANTHROPIC_DEFAULT_OPUS_MODEL=deepseek-v4-pro[1m] set ANTHROPIC_DEFAULT_SONNET_MODEL=deepseek-v4-pro[1m] set ANTHROPIC_DEFAULT_HAIKU_MODEL=deepseek-v4-flash set CLAUDE_CODE_SUBAGENT_MODEL=deepseek-v4-flash

key(在API登录,新建key)

3.配置完成,执行claude命令,即可开始使用了。
claude
4.装完claude,请优先执行接下来这个命令,需更改命令中的key,修改成自己的
请解决claude临时终端环境变量,命令仅当前CMD/PowerShell窗口生效,关闭终端后变量直接销毁,新开窗口环境清空,需要重输密钥 / 重登录,这是环境变量命令set ANTHROPIC_BASE_URL=https://api.deepseek.com/anthropic set ANTHROPIC_AUTH_TOKEN=你的key set ANTHROPIC_MODEL=deepseek-v4-pro[1m] set ANTHROPIC_DEFAULT_OPUS_MODEL=deepseek-v4-pro[1m] set ANTHROPIC_DEFAULT_SONNET_MODEL=deepseek-v4-pro[1m] set ANTHROPIC_DEFAULT_HAIKU_MODEL=deepseek-v4-flash set CLAUDE_CODE_SUBAGENT_MODEL=deepseek-v4-flash

5.执行完每次打开都自动登录

http://www.zskr.cn/news/1469801.html

相关文章:

  • 学完吴恩达第一周,我整理了这份深度学习避坑指南:从数据、算力到算法选择
  • Sora 2科学可视化不是“视频生成”,而是新一代计算叙事引擎(附IEEE VIS 2024预印本验证数据)
  • ai赋能内容平台:借助快马平台大模型为ao3镜像站实现智能标签与推荐
  • 【毕业设计】基于springboot+微信小程序的在线预约挂号系统基于微信小程序的智能在线预约挂号系统(源码+文档+远程调试,全bao定制等)
  • Gemini世界观构建:3天内完成从Prompt工程师到认知架构师的跃迁路径
  • 法律检索响应时间从15分钟压缩至8秒:北京知识产权法院AI辅助裁判系统内部操作手册首度流出
  • GEO优化公司推荐名单有哪些?GEO是什么公司?2026年6月国内GEO服务商TOP6综合测评 - 互联网科技品牌测评
  • 博主实测:为什么说德源 DYG5001 是 IGBT 封装中 3M 5413 的最强替身?
  • 如何快速解密科学文库PDF:3分钟完整破解指南
  • Anthropic千亿估值买不来未来:类脑智能正在逆袭
  • 荣获参与奖哈哈
  • 新手零基础入门:借助快马ai生成你的第一个数据库交互网页应用
  • 2026宜昌防水补漏哪家好?住建实地测评权威榜单TOP5|卫生间免砸砖/阳台屋顶/厨卫漏水维修(6月宜昌专项调研) - 苏易修缮
  • AI辅助开发新体验:描述你的创意,让快马AI自动生成炫酷加载动画代码
  • tmux 在生物信息项目中的妙用 —— 尤其是搭配 Claude Code 时
  • 上周用飞算JavaAI搓了个订单系统,真实手感如何?
  • 为啥换热板片带波纹?换热效率差别这么大?
  • OpenClaw 和 MCP 怎么接:把浏览器能力做成 Agent 可控工具
  • 【实战指南】从树莓派/Arduino迁移到youyeetoo K1:开发者完整攻略
  • 实战演练:基于快马AI快速开发一个带交互功能的飞鸟云官网Demo
  • 095、检测结果存储与分析平台:PostgreSQL/ClickHouse + Grafana 搭建检测数据分析
  • 2026年减速机源头厂家强力推荐榜:斜齿轮减速机、摆线减速机、四大系列及轴承传动设备优选指南 - 品牌企业推荐师(官方)
  • 如何通过开源工具实现B站直播推流码获取与专业级推流配置
  • 2026年真空乳化搅拌机/乳化机/均质机/管线式乳化机厂家推荐:精密均质与智能配液技术深度解析 - 品牌企业推荐师(官方)
  • KEIL开发避坑指南:这7个编译警告别忽视,尤其是第3个新手常犯
  • 亿达科创深圳新址启用 锚定湾区打造数字服务新标杆
  • 义乌靠谱购宠攻略|认准稠江明轩猫犬舍连锁老店,告别网购星期宠 - 萌宠俱乐部
  • 都2026年了,鸿蒙版微信这10大误区早已是历史
  • 如何用Arduino-ESP32快速构建物联网项目?从入门到实战的完整指南
  • 2026年软件工程师与产品经理的角色重定位